Output 955c91cc993204a7436b01d4d64ced4dbf53f30ec13f784f17f89ab6b30050bc:0

value
10634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cdff30f5a0f23167e43ad72a4c1a33651171f1a OP_EQUAL
address
3AA6NUPDKV1Np4LzUVNAivotBT6J9ZX1BJ
transaction
955c91cc993204a7436b01d4d64ced4dbf53f30ec13f784f17f89ab6b30050bc
spent
true